Overview

Bental Industries Ltd. is a leading design & manufacturing company in the field of power & motion components and systems for land and air defense platforms. Bental designs products which are based on the company’s comprehensive line of onboard integrated solutions for AFVs, missiles, satellites and UAVs including sophisticated servo motors, servo actuators, cutting-edge propulsion systems, alternators and starters, and mini stabilized payload systems of surveillance application. Bental manufacture abilities run from small to high-volume series with a proven ability to ramp – up production of new and complicated products in a short time (As for example – motors to the MRAP program). Bental performs as the electric power and motion developer & manufacturer for the Israeli MOD and MAFAT. Bental list of customers includes the A&D leading companies in Israel and abroad, serving the most advance and complex projects. Ownership: Bental is 70% owned by TAT Technologies and 30% by Kibbutz Merom-Golan. In house technologies: Production: Machining, winding, impregnation, balancing, assembly, wire harnessing, heat treatment, laser marking, clean room assembly, XYZ mechanical control. Engineering tools: • Final elements for electro-magnetic design • PC Opera & Matcad for thermal analysis • Solid Edge for mechanic design • Matcad, Orcad & Cimulink for calculations • Embedded systems for software writing • Lab-view for testing • Vibration and noise measurement facility • Spectrum Analyzer Quality: ISO 9001 2000 Products: • Brush & Brushless motors • Blowers & Dust Scavengers • Mini stabilized Payload System for Mini & Micro UAVs • Propulsion Systems • Alternators & Starter Alternators • High speed Alternators • Servo Actuators
